PINTEREST SHARES HOLIDAY GIFT TREND INSIGHTS BASED ON RISING PIN SEARCH VOLUME, pinterest

According to Pinterest data, the top “trending aesthetic” among Gen Z ahead of the holidays is *checks notes* fairy grunge. This entails black platform boots, ‘Goblincore sweatshirts,’ and “whimsical elements such as beaded necklaces and gothic styles.” In other #aesthetic news…

DREAMCORE, SISTER TO WEIRDCORE, IS THE INTERNET AESTHETIC PACKED WITH UNEASINESS, nylon

Based in surrealism and “floating in the ether somewhere between weirdcore and traumacore,” the best way to describe dreamcore “is having the same feeling as a David Lynch movie, a Twilight Zone episode, or a Cocteau Twins song.” Style-wise, that translates to Beetlejuice’s pinstripe suit, trippy patterns, and Frank Ocean on the Met Gala red carpet with a little neon baby.

THEY STARTED MAKING TIKTOKS FOR JOE BIDEN. NOW GEN Z FOR CHANGE WANTS TO WIELD REAL POLITICAL CLOUT, dailydot

This coalition of over 400 Gen Z creators has organized for the Georgia Senate run-offs, partnered with Dr. Anthony Fauci during the COVID-19 vaccine rollout, and worked with Stacey Abram’s FairFight, Climate Power, MTV, and others. Now they’ve taken another step towards growing their influence: organizing as 501c4.

‘THIS IS THE WILD WEST’: HOW AN INVESTMENT STARTUP BRAND IS BUILDING COMMUNITY TRUST WITH DISCORD, digiday

It’s a smart play for alternative investment platform Otis. When it comes to getting in front of Gen Z, “we’re at a crossroads, where brands are starting to function less like brands and more like people.”
